之前发过一篇转.arff文件的博客,后来发现是错的。。。,weka虽然能识别,但是并不能进行聚类或者分类,原因是我没有提取数据集中的类别信息,也就是说我将其中的类标也看成一个属性了。。。而且为了方便转换,做了一个再简单不过的界面,(主要是需要转换的文件太多了,不想一个一个改路径。。。)如下图,直接选中就可以转换了:
第一个显示你要选择的文件,第二个显示你是否转换成功。
这里我用的环境是Eclipse+window buider swing,window buider没装的可以百度一下,都有的,是一个图形界面的插件。装好以后选择File --> New -> other --> window buider --> swing desinger --> application window
建好以后把下面的代码复制全部粘贴进去即可(全选覆盖它自动生成的代码)
步骤:
首先你得将数据集保存为.txt文件,因为初始的UCR数据集我的电脑是不能识别为一个.xxx文件的,需要转为.txt文件,不要用记事本,卡出翔,推荐用Node pade++ 用它打开后另存为.txt文件即可,
